About the Business

Menards is a popular hardware and home goods store located at 1380 Fort Harrison Road in Terre Haute, Indiana. With a wide range of products including tools, building materials, appliances, and home decor, Menards is a one-stop shop for all your home improvement needs. Whether you are a DIY enthusiast or a professional contractor, you will find everything you need at Menards. The store offers competitive prices, knowledgeable staff, and a convenient location for customers in Terre Haute and the surrounding areas.
